Peter Körner wrote:
> - when all conflicts are resolved <tool> generates a voting-url
I'm against voting. Voting is a way to take responsibility away from the
individual. I think that in most cases we should strive to have
individuals responsible for everything (just like with mapping - you
don't suggest something which the community then votes upon, you just map).
You break the roads in my village - I repair it. If it later turns out
that I was too quick and indeed your edits were mostly good, then it is
my fault and I have to take responsibility for this. This means that I
will be careful with reverting stuff.
On the other hand, if you create this voting apparatus then this works
like a lynch mob where nobody actually feels responsible for anything.
Later you have the dead newbie hanging from a tree and everybody says
"wasn't me!".
